Transaction 8fed103e5d2f1086651182fc3016731f46dc6900fe6f2083511230e22efefe9b

1 Input
2 Outputs
  • 8fed103e5d2f1086651182fc3016731f46dc6900fe6f2083511230e22efefe9b:0
  • value  579565
    address  34HsmkcpxXmfFsrmRZvnbXgVGbMSVpSKAJ
  • 8fed103e5d2f1086651182fc3016731f46dc6900fe6f2083511230e22efefe9b:1
  • value  26754724
    address  1Mi9hir9hPjEVrNWpxgGZiQpVjgwLKMrGt